Figure Out How Many Solar Panels You Require

Going solar has become increasingly popular, and for good reason! Harnessing the power of the sun to produce electricity offers a clean, renewable energy source. But before you dive into the world of solar panels, a crucial question arises: How many do you actually need? The answer isn't one-size-fits-all and depends on a few key factors.

  • Your typical energy consumption plays a major role. If you tend to use more electricity during peak hours, you'll likely require a larger solar panel system.
  • Where you live|The amount of sunlight your area receives significantly impacts your system's output. Regions with longer, sunnier days can generate more electricity from the same number of panels.
  • Your roof space and its direction also matter. A larger, south-facing roof is generally ideal for solar panel installations.

Once you have a good grasp of your energy needs and local conditions, there are several online calculators available to help you estimate the number of panels you'll need. These tools typically ask for your energy consumption, location, and roof details, providing a personalized estimate.
